unionlearn Quality Award
By 2010 we expect over 250,000 learners to progress through the union route each year. In order to continually promote high quality, flexible learning opportunities, we will work closely with providers in the learning world. The unionlearn Quality Award will be awarded to providers who are committed to working with trade unions and can demonstrate that unions and union learners are considered in the design, development and delivery of courses and programmes. To gain the unionlearn Quality Award, providers must have a robust process for working with unions. The Award will be easily recognised by growing numbers of ULRs and union learners as a mark of good practice. Providers achieving the Award for their courses and programmes will also be publicised on our website. John Hayes, skills minister, presents Quality Awards
Speaking at Learning 4 Life, unionlearn's annual conference in London, John Hayes, minister for further education, skills and lifelong learning paid tribute to the contribution of unions and their partners to raising skills in the workplace. Presenting the awards with Brendan Barber, TUC general secretary, he said: “These quality awards provide a clear signpost to both learners and employers of where they can find good learning. And that's why I'm so pleased to be here and to have this chance to offer my congratulations in person to this year's award-winners.”

New award for careers information and advice
Unionlearn is introducing a new version of the Quality Award for careers information and advice. The new award will be available to all national, regional and local services with a robust process for working with unions, and who can meet the assessment criteria. Providers achieving the award for their services will be publicised on the unionlearn website.
